    I finally got around to taking my Z to the drag strip. I'm running a 3.0L stroker motor with bored out SU carbs. 3.7 LSD, with 1983 280zx 5speed tranny, street tires, and my best time was a 15.103 with a .807 reaction time. Is this a good time for this type of set up??? I did notice that my car would hesitate a little around 5500 rpms, kind of went on and off up to 7000. I crossed the finish line in 3rd gear, at around 5900 rpms at 94 mph. I'm guessing my gear ratio is a little tall for drag racing, or I could probably get solid 14's.
